About Us:
Otto Car is one of the UK’s fastest-growing private companies in the mobility sector. Helping to get private hire drivers on the road to ownership, our mission is to bring our loved ones home safely. With roots in London, we are expanding our reach to bring affordable, sustainable vehicle ownership solutions to drivers across the UK.
Since our humble beginnings with a single Toyota Prius nine years ago, we’ve grown into Europe’s largest fleet of electric cars on platforms like Uber and Bolt, with thousands of vehicles on the road. We’ve supported over 20,000 drivers in achieving financial independence and are proud to lead the way in helping private hire drivers transition to a greener future.

About the role:
The Regional Operations Co-Ordinator is responsible for ensuring operational rigour, regulatory compliance and process excellence across Otto Car’s regional expansion and delivery workflows.
The role will act as a central hub for documentation, compliance oversight, playbook management and process improvement, creating the structure and best practice frameworks that enable regional teams to operate at scale.
Key Responsibilities
Operational Support & Administration
- Provide day to day coordination across regional operations, ensuring accurate tracking of vehicle delivery and licensing activities.
- Maintain high standards of document management, including licence applications, compliance submissions and customer records.
- Own updates to delivery pipelines, ensuring timely communication of progress to stakeholders.
- Act as an escalation point for administrative and operational blockers.
Compliance & Council Liaison
- Build and maintain expertise on local authority licensing and compliance requirements, with a focus on ensuring Otto Car stays ahead of regulatory change.
- Submit and track licence applications, proactively following up with councils to prevent delays.
- Maintain a live repository of regional authority requirements to inform internal teams and customers.
- Liaise directly with councils to resolve compliance issues, escalating to leadership where necessary.
Playbook Management & Best Practice
- Develop, manage and continuously improve the Regional Operations Playbook.
- Translate regulatory and operational requirements into practical, step by step guidance for teams.
- Embed best practice across processes, ensuring consistency in execution across regions.
- Partner with leadership and frontline teams to ensure playbooks remain current, relevant and aligned with business needs.
Business Process & Continuous Improvement
- Review and refine regional workflows to identify efficiency gains and risk reduction opportunities.
- Standardise administrative processes to improve accuracy, compliance and speed of execution.
- Provide structured reporting on operational KPIs, surfacing risks and opportunities to management.
- Benchmark Otto’s regional operations against market best practice, proactively recommending improvements.
Skills and Qualifications:
- Exceptional organisational and administrative capability with a meticulous attention to detail.
- Ability to interpret, simplify and communicate complex regulatory requirements.
- Strong process design and documentation skills, with the ability to create structured playbooks and SOPs.
- Proactive mindset with strong problem-solving capabilities.
- Effective communicator, confident when engaging with councils, customers, and internal stakeholders.
- Self-starter who thrives in an autonomous role but collaborates effectively across teams.
